edward.robbins@domain.hid wrote:
> Thanks, this script sounds like exactly what I need. I downloaded the
> latest snapshot of mkrootfs from git, but I don't want to install that
> on my rootfs. I'd just download the script alone, but looking at it I
> see it would want to run a script in /ltp as well, so I guess I need ltp
> too. Can you tell me an easier way to set up dohell that might save me
> sifting through the whole of ltp and mkrootfs to figure it out?

Well, you need to compile LTP. Building LTP (at least the version we use
to validate Xenomai) is a bit peculiar in cross-compiled environment,
but should be straight-forward if you are not cross-compiling. You
should find some documentation here:
http://ltp.sourceforge.net/documentation/how-to/ltp.php
